Transaction 45a18aa122dd88e9373054555b8048058a7af6f34efc72541a4684a32acd609f

1 Input
2 Outputs
  • 45a18aa122dd88e9373054555b8048058a7af6f34efc72541a4684a32acd609f:0
  • value  495281746
    address  1Kx83Vzs1sPQTKE2EkDEJrxxz2S5EQonbQ
  • 45a18aa122dd88e9373054555b8048058a7af6f34efc72541a4684a32acd609f:1
  • value  704279
    address  1Mo2arrPnq59RAqVqXgesEAd4nbFdPhca8